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/css/34.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 将symfony2安装在流浪汉上_Php_Symfony_Vagrant_Symfony 2.1_Homestead - Fatal编程技术网

Php 将symfony2安装在流浪汉上

Php 将symfony2安装在流浪汉上,php,symfony,vagrant,symfony-2.1,homestead,Php,Symfony,Vagrant,Symfony 2.1,Homestead,我试图在vagrant上运行symfony,但我有一个错误: "NetworkError: 500 hphp_invoke - http://test.com:8000/" My test.com: server { listen 80; server_name test.com; root /home/vagrant/Workspace/test/web; index app_dev.php; access_log off; error_log /var/log/nginx/test.co

我试图在vagrant上运行symfony,但我有一个错误:

"NetworkError: 500 hphp_invoke - http://test.com:8000/"
My test.com:

server {
listen 80;
server_name test.com;
root /home/vagrant/Workspace/test/web;
index app_dev.php;

access_log off;
error_log /var/log/nginx/test.com-error.log error;

location / {
 if (-f $request_filename) {
   expires max;
   break;
  }

if ($request_filename !~ "\.(js|htc|ico|gif|jpg|png|css)$") {
  rewrite ^(.*) /app_dev.php last;
 }
}

location ~ \.php($|/) {
 set $script $uri;
 set  $path_info  "";
 if ($uri ~ "^(.+\.php)(/.+)") {
  set $script $1;
  set $path_info $2;
}

fastcgi_pass 127.0.0.1:9000;
include fastcgi_params;
fastcgi_param PATH_INFO $path_info;
fastcgi_param SCRIPT_FILENAME $document_root/$script;
fastcgi_param SCRIPT_NAME $script;
}
}
我的app_dev.php:

$loader = require_once __DIR__.'/../app/bootstrap.php.cache';
Debug::enable();
require_once __DIR__.'/../app/AppKernel.php';
$kernel = new AppKernel('dev', true);
$kernel->loadClassCache();
$request = Request::createFromGlobals();
$response = $kernel->handle($request);
$response->send();
$kernel->terminate($request, $response);
我查看了日志,没有任何错误。
我在我的主机127.0.0.1 test.com中添加了。我删除了缓存。请帮帮我

解决方案是更改location/,如下所示:location/{try_files$uri/app.php;}